SWITCH CASE DENGAN LOOPING

 A. Tampilan Program

1. Program Menghitung Gaji Karyawan





2. Program Menghitung Inputan Bilangan








B. Source Code


using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;

namespace SILVIA_RANTI_20312073_IF_20B
{
    class Program
    {
        static void Main(string[] args)
        {
        int input;
        Console.WriteLine("=========================================");
        Console.WriteLine("1.Program Menghitung Gaji Karyawan");
        Console.WriteLine("2.Program Menghitung Inputan Bilangan");
        Console.WriteLine("=========================================");
        Console.Write("Masukan Pilihan Anda = ");
        input = int.Parse(Console.ReadLine());
        switch (input)
        {
          case 1:
            int jumlahkaryawan, lembur, bonus, gajitotal;
            string nama;
            Console.Write("Masukan jumlah karyawan = ");
            jumlahkaryawan = int.Parse(Console.ReadLine());
            for (int i = 0; i < jumlahkaryawan; i++)
            {
                Console.Write("Masukan nama Anda = ");
                nama = Console.ReadLine();
                Console.Write("Masukan jam lembur Anda = ");
                lembur = int.Parse(Console.ReadLine());
                bonus = lembur * 50000;
                gajitotal = 2000000 + bonus;
                Console.WriteLine("Nama = " + nama);
                Console.WriteLine("Bonus Anda = " + bonus);
                Console.WriteLine("Total Gaji = " + gajitotal);
            }
            break;
          case 2:
            int banyakdata, nilai;
            int totalnilai = 0;
            Console.Write("Masukan banyaknya data = ");
            banyakdata = int.Parse(Console.ReadLine());
            for (int i = 1; i <= banyakdata; i++)
            {
              Console.Write("Nilai ke-" + i + ": ");
              nilai = int.Parse(Console.ReadLine());
              totalnilai += nilai;
            }
            Console.Write("Jumlah nilai yang dimasukan: " + totalnilai);
            break;
          default:
              Console.Write("Pilihan yang Anda masukan salah!!!");
              break;
        }
      Console.ReadLine();
    }
  }
}

Tidak ada komentar:

Posting Komentar

 ARRAY 1 DIMENSI   Array  merupakan suatu variabel tipe data terstruktur yang berguna untuk menyimpan sejumlah data yang bertipe sama. Bagia...